Dolph Ziggler Impressed By Big E's Growth In WWE

Big E used to be paired with Ziggler in WWE

Dolph Ziggler is full of praise for how far Big E has come in WWE. 

Big E started as Ziggler's muscle and enforcer on the WWE main roster back in 2011 and was by The Show-Off's side when he cashed in Money In The Bank to become World Heavyweight Champion. Just under ten years later, Big E did the same, and now holds the WWE Title.

The two former partners collided recently at WWE Tribute To The Troops, and Ziggler knew that Big E would go far in WWE.

Speaking on WWE's The Bump, Ziggler said: "Do you know how hard it is to be World Champion in this business? It's hard to do even for the best of the best.

"So when I first saw him, I went like 'This guy looks like he's in the zone.' I had seen him work out. I knew he was breaking records, lifting weights. So he's going to stand here and watch my back and he gets to learn from one of the best going and hopefully he applies that and he becomes great down the line.

"He was great from the moment he stepped in as a hard working kid and now as the flagship guy of his brand."
